The Emir of the State of Qatar, Sheikh Tamim bin Hamad Al Thani, congratulated the Somali and Kenyan Presidents for what he described as their wise and courageous decision to restore diplomatic relations between the two countries.
Sheikh Tamim expressed his wishes for security and stability to Somalia, Kenya and their peoples, stressing that Qatar will always be a striving for good and a maker of peace.
The Somali Ministry of Information announced today, Thursday, the restoration of diplomatic relations between Kenya and Somalia, after they were interrupted for 5 months, after Mogadishu accused Nairobi of interfering in its internal affairs.
At a press conference in the Somali capital, Mogadishu, Abd al-Rahman Yusuf, the Somali Deputy Minister of Information, said that relations between Nairobi and Mogadishu had returned thanks to Qatari efforts.
The Somali official thanked the Emir of the State of Qatar for his efforts to restore relations between the two African countries.
Yusuf said that, in the interest of good neighborliness, Somalia announced the resumption of diplomatic relations with Kenya, adding that the Republic of Kenya welcomes this step which aims to protect the interests of good neighborliness between the two countries.
For its part, the Kenyan Foreign Ministry confirmed the resumption of diplomatic relations with Somalia, and said that it appreciates what it described as the continued support of the international community – especially the government of Qatar – in the normalization of relations with Somalia.
The Kenyan Foreign Ministry said that we are looking forward to the normalization of relations with the Somali authorities in trade, communication, transport and cultural exchange.
